Any suggestions for this pc im going to build. ALL CANADIAN CASH

The NV3 often uses QLC flash, which has low durability and becomes noticeably slower after a few years, so it should not be used as the OS drive. Get a better drive with TLC flash like the Patriot P320, Patriot P400 Lite, or TeamGroup G50.
